Output 7faadb280b94c3482eafbd5c04437790cc3c98b9d4826ae49f8e586b61a834e0:12

value
159000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66a7cae6c4a04db8ea78257b2baad843c07f91f4 OP_EQUAL
address
3B3orYUnwDBv5HxviDXSzMqMtHdv5zG4qA
transaction
7faadb280b94c3482eafbd5c04437790cc3c98b9d4826ae49f8e586b61a834e0
spent
true